May 7, 2012 Justice Yvette McGee Brown - "Law Day" On Jan. 1, 2011, Yvette McGee Brown became the 153rd Justice to join the Supreme Court of Ohio. Justice Brown is the first African-American woman to serve on the Supreme Court of Ohio, and the eighth female Justice in the Court's history. A common theme in Justice Brown's professional and community work is her advocacy for children and families. An active community and corporate leader, Justice Brown has served on the boards of Ohio University, The Ohio State University Medical Center, the National Council of the OSU Moritz College of Law, M/1 Homes Inc, and Fifth Third Bank of Central Ohio.

February 13, 2012 Dr. Richard Ruppert & Tom Palmer- Better Government, Better Furture, Better Jobs. Dick is a retired President of the former Medical College of Ohio and before that was a distinguished professor of Medicine at OSU. Tom is a managing partner at Marshall & Melhorn. Both Tom and Dick have been on boards and in leadership positions in a number of civic organizations including the RGP and Toledo Lucas County Port Authority. They shared the key study recommendations of the Lucas County Citizen Review. They explainrf how the changes in the structure of Lucas County government will benefit Lucas County residents and NW Ohio. In additon, they described the necessary steps to secure a place for the Charter initiative on the 2012 November ballot.

Yagi Takeru has been living in the TÃ Âma family's house since his parents are gone. He was raised by TÃ Âma Rokunosuke, the head of the house. He is surrounded by many people such as Yamato Takeshi, his best friend/rival from the kendo club, the Shiratori sisters, Kotono and Asuka, and his childhood friend, Osu Seri. Life has been blissful until one day, an earthquake strikes the school and everything changes. Takeru awakens to find that the school looks as if it has been abandoned for centuries and reduced to ruins. He also realize that all the teachers and students have disappeared as well. He meets up with Seri and Asuka and they fled from the ruins, only to realize that the town they used to live in is completely empty. Subsequently, people wrapped in cloaks appear before him. They were told that they have been brought to another world.
